Men’s Golf Off to Slow Start at Patriot League Championship

HELLERTOWN, Pa. – The Bucknell men's golf team had a tough opening day at the Patriot League Championship, posting a 311 team score to fall to eighth place in the standings. Jason Lohwater and Michael Rudnick paced the Bison with 4-over-par 76s at the Steel Club.
Lohwater birdied the opening hole, then had a run of three straight birdies at holes 13-15. Rudnick made two birdies on the way to his 76, and the Bison duo sit in a tie for 18th place on the individual leaderboard.
Jack Gardner followed with a 79, and Blake Wisdom, Jackson Bussell, and Josh Holtschlag all shot 80 in the play-6, count-4 format.
Host Lafayette and Loyola are tied for the team lead after posting 294s. Lehigh and Holy Cross are tied for third at 297, followed by Colgate (299), Army (301), Navy (304), and Bucknell.
Only two players broke par on a breezy day in the Lehigh Valley. Lafayette's Ryan Tall posted a 3-under 69 and is two strokes clear of Holy Cross' Christian Emmerich. Four others sit at even par.
Bucknell will be paired with Navy for round two on Saturday, with tee times starting at 8 a.m.
